The Current Landscape of the Auto Parts Market

As we move deeper into 2023, the automotive parts market remains steady, reflecting a balance between demand and supply. Factors such as the increasing adoption of electric vehicles (EVs) and strategic investments in automotive technology are pivotal. With countries like Indonesia taking significant steps in the EV sector, the implications for the overall market are profound. The strong demand for auto parts is particularly pronounced in Southeast Asia, where countries like Indonesia, Malaysia, and Thailand are ramping up production capabilities to meet both local and export needs.

The Role of Electric Vehicles

The rise of electric vehicles is more than a trend; it's a transformation. According to a recent report, EV sales in Southeast Asia could double by 2025, making this a critical time for automotive parts suppliers. The shift to electrification is unprecedented, requiring a re-evaluation of the manufacturing processes, materials used, and the components that make up vehicles.

Market Dynamics in Southeast Asia

In markets such as Jakarta, Surabaya, and Bali, demand for auto parts is surging. The Indonesian government has put forth ambitious targets to increase local EV production, providing an excellent opportunity for automotive parts exporters to capitalize on this growth. Recent data suggests that the market for auto parts is expected to grow by 15% annually, underscoring the importance of timely investments and production adjustments.

Regulatory Influences

New regulations aimed at reducing carbon footprints are influencing how parts are developed and exported. For instance, the ASEAN framework encourages collaborations between member states to streamline production and trade processes. Exporters are urged to align with these regulations to access broader markets and remain competitive.

Future Outlook for the Auto Parts Industry

Looking ahead, the outlook for the auto parts industry remains promising, with several indicators pointing toward sustained growth. Industry analysts believe that as EV technology matures, there will be a substantial demand for parts such as batteries, electric drivetrains, and smart vehicle components. The shift is not just limited to passenger vehicles; commercial fleets are also moving towards electrification, further broadening the market base.
